Transaction 77564d4bcbfc790090874a3f8f0903cd916798f868b5fb6594fa23bcc153031a

2 Input
2 Outputs
  • 77564d4bcbfc790090874a3f8f0903cd916798f868b5fb6594fa23bcc153031a:0
  • value  1997396
    address  2NFxrCZu8kgJ4ZHTGiGc3Q7njSHxgjvLyvM
  • 77564d4bcbfc790090874a3f8f0903cd916798f868b5fb6594fa23bcc153031a:1
  • value  1000000
    address  2MyZUEEDKTSnxcvdk7c4xeYU8ohxNV3oXtM